"Located on Flushing’s Prince Street, Nan Xiang Xiao Long Bao has been the city's most popular vendor of soup dumplings since about 2006; I note it's a modest spot that has amassed over 100 pages of laudatory Yelp reviews and that waits at meal times can total an hour or more — for dumplings." - Eater Staff